Главная страница
Навигация по странице:

  • «Библиотечный фонд города»

  • ПР1_ТЗ_Гудков_вариант_6. Утверждаю согласовано


    Скачать 35.63 Kb.
    НазваниеУтверждаю согласовано
    Дата12.02.2019
    Размер35.63 Kb.
    Формат файлаdocx
    Имя файлаПР1_ТЗ_Гудков_вариант_6.docx
    ТипТехническое задание
    #67273

    "







    УТВЕРЖДАЮ

    СОГЛАСОВАНО







    Директор ООО «ГРУША»

    Директор ООО «ЯБЛОКО»

    ______________А.Б. Виноградов

    ___________Г.Д. Ежевичка

    «____» ______________ 2019 г.

    «____» ______________ 2019 г.

    ТЕХНИЧЕСКОЕ ЗАДАНИЕ

    на разработку информационной системы

    «Библиотечный фонд города»







    2019 г.

    ОГЛАВЛЕНИЕ




    1.НАИМЕНОВАНИЕ И ОБЛАСТЬ ПРИМЕНЕНИЯ 2

    2.ОСНОВАНИЕ ДЛЯ РАЗРАБОТКИ 4

    3.НАЗНАЧЕНИЕ РАЗРАБОТКИ 5

    3.1.Функциональное назначение 5

    3.2.Эксплуатационное назначение 5

    4.ТЕХНИЧЕСКИЕ ТРЕБОВАНИЯ К ПРОГРАММЕ 6

    4.1.Требования к функциональным характеристикам 6

    4.2.Требования к надежности 7

    5.ТЕХНИКО-ЭКОНОМИЧЕСКИЕ ПОКАЗАТЕЛИ 9

    6.СТАДИИ И ЭТАПЫ РАЗРАБОТКИ 10

    7.ПОРЯДОК КОНТРОЛЯ И ПРИЕМКИ 11


    1. НАИМЕНОВАНИЕ И ОБЛАСТЬ ПРИМЕНЕНИЯ


    Наименование: Информационная система библиотечного фонда города.

    Библиотечный фонд города составляют библиотеки, расположенные на территории города. Каждая библиотека включает в себя абонементы и читальные залы. Пользователями библиотек являются различные категории читателей: студенты, научные работники, преподаватели, школьники, рабочие, пенсионеры и другие жители города. Каждая категория читателей может обладать непересекающимися характеристи-ками-атрибутами: для студентов это название учебного заведения, факультет, курс, номер группы, для научного работника -название организации, научная тема и т.д. Каждый читатель, будучи зарегистрированным в одной из библиотек, имеет доступ ко всему библиотечному фонду города.

    Библиотечный фонд (книги, журналы, газеты, сборники статей, сборники стихов, диссертации, рефераты, сборники докладов и тезисов докладов и пр.) размещен в залах-хранилищах различных библиотек на определенных местах хранения (номер зала, стеллажа, полки) и идентифицируется номенклатурными номерами. При этом существуют различные правила относительно тех или иных изданий: какие-то подлежат только чтению в читальных залах библиотек, для тех, что выдаются, может быть установлен различный срок выдачи и т.д. С одной стороны, библиотечный фонд может пополняться, с другой, - с течением времени происходит его списание.

    Произведения авторов, составляющие библиотечный фонд, также можно разделить на различные категории, характеризующиеся собственным набором атрибутов: учебники, повести, романы, статьи, стихи, диссертации, рефераты, тезисы докладов и т.д.

    Сотрудники библиотеки, работающие в различных залах различных библиотек, ведут учет читателей, а также учет размещения и выдачи литературы.

    1. ОСНОВАНИЕ ДЛЯ РАЗРАБОТКИ


    Основанием для разработки ИС является заказ администрации библиотечного фонда города.

    Номер контракта: №7 от 1.02.2019.

    Наименование разработки: ИС библиотечного фонда города.

    1. НАЗНАЧЕНИЕ РАЗРАБОТКИ



      1. Функциональное назначение


    Программа позволяет быстро и достаточно легко редактировать базу данных (добавлять новые записи, удалять старые, вносить необходимые изменения в существующие записи).
      1. Эксплуатационное назначение


    Программа применяется пользователем для автоматизации учета о существующей литературе, об особенностях читателей, количестве свободных и занятых книг.

    1. ТЕХНИЧЕСКИЕ ТРЕБОВАНИЯ К ПРОГРАММЕ



      1. Требования к функциональным характеристикам


    - Получение списка читателей с заданными характеристиками: студентов указанного учебного заведения, факультета, научных работников по определенной тематике и т.д.

    - Выдача перечня читателей, на руках у которых находится указанное произведение.

    - Получение списка читателей, на руках у которых находится указанное издание (книга, журнал и т.д).

    - Получение перечня читателей, которые в течение указанного промежутка времени получали издание с некоторым произведением, и название этого издания.

    - Выдача списка изданий, которые в течение некоторого времени получал указанный читатель из фонда библиотеки, где он зарегистрирован.

    - Получение перечня изданий, которыми в течение некоторого времени пользовался указанный читатель из фонда библиотеки, где он не зарегистрирован.

    - Получение списка литературы, которая в настоящий момент выдана с определенной полки некоторой библиотеки.

    - Выдача списка читателей, которые в течение обозначенного периода были обслужены указанным библиотекарем.

    - Получение данных о выработке библиотекарей (число обслуженных читателей в указанный период времени).

    - Получение списка читателей с просроченным сроком литературы.

    - Получение перечня указанной литературы, которая поступила (была списана) в течение некоторого периода.

    - Выдача списка библиотекарей, работающих в указанном читальном зале некоторой библиотеки.

    - Получение списка читателей, не посещавших библиотеку в течение указанного времени.

    - Получение списка инвентарных номеров и названий из библиотечного фонда, в которых содержится указанное произведение.

    - Выдача списка инвентарных номеров и названий из библиотечного фонда, в которых содержатся произведения указанного автора.

    - Получение списка самых популярных произведений.

    Входными данными является текст запроса и указанные временные промежутки.

    Выходными данными является отчет, который формируется на основании результатов запроса.
      1. Требования к надежности


    Система должна сохранять работоспособность и обеспечивать восстановление своих функций при возникновении следующих внештатных ситуаций:

    - при сбоях в системе электроснабжения аппаратной части, приводящих к перезагрузке ОС, восстановление программы должно происходить после перезапуска ОС и запуска исполняемого файла системы;

    - при ошибках в работе аппаратных средств (кроме носителей данных и программ) восстановление функции системы возлагается на ОС;

    - при ошибках, связанных с программным обеспечением (ОС и драйверы устройств), восстановление работоспособности возлагается на ОС.

    Для защиты аппаратуры от скачков напряжения и коммутационных помех должны применяться сетевые фильтры.

      1. Требования к составу и параметрам технических средств

    В состав комплекса должны входить следующие технические средства:

    - ПК пользователей;

    - ПК администраторов.

    Требования к техническим характеристикам ПК пользователей и ПК администраторов:

    - процессор – Intel Core i3-6100 CPU 3.70GHz;

    - объем оперативной памяти – 8 ГБ;

    - дисковая подсистема – CCWORM 1024 МБ;

    - сетевой адаптер – Realtek PCle GBE Family Controller.

      1. Требования к информационной и программной совместимости

    Используемая ОС: Windows 10 Корпоративная.

    Используемая СУБД: Microsoft SQL Server.

    Языки программирования, на которых производится разработка: C#, SQL.

    1. ТЕХНИКО-ЭКОНОМИЧЕСКИЕ ПОКАЗАТЕЛИ


    Данная ИС по сравнению с уже существующими аналогичными программными продуктами позволит повысить эффективность обработки данных и улучшить качество работы сотрудников библиотечного фонда города.

    1. СТАДИИ И ЭТАПЫ РАЗРАБОТКИ




    1. Проектирование

    - Выдача заданий;

    - Анализ предметной области;

    - Проектирование ИС.

    2) Разработка

    - Разработка базы данных и запросов на языке SQL;

    - Разработка интерфейса пользователя;

    - Тестирование и отладка;

    - Создание руководства пользователя;

    - Создание руководства системного администратора.

    3) Внедрение

    - Внедрение информационной системы;

    - Приемо-сдаточные испытания.

    1. ПОРЯДОК КОНТРОЛЯ И ПРИЕМКИ


    Сдача и приемка ИС библиотечного фонда города осуществляется на основе результатов тестирования, проводимого представителями Заказчика и Исполнителя в соответствии с программой приемо-сдаточных испытаний, которая формируется совместно. В программе приемо-сдаточных испытаний должны быть указаны виды, состав, объем и методы проверки правильности получения выходных данных и соответствия системы требованиям данного технического задания.


    написать администратору сайта